Quite a bit of progress since your last release. This is taking shape very nicely, did you make a custom landclass for the area? It seems to fit real world pics much better than the default.

The parking situation seems ok so far, everyone seems to find their spots, NASA included. I haven't had time to wait for the ai to do takeoffs/landings, though so no feedback on the taxi situation yet.
The base sits about 25ft above the default, which, being the is correct real-world altitude, caused the usual subterranean effect (I corrected the FS bgl with JaBBgl).

Some missing autogen near the center of the base, not really that noticeable most of the time.

The only real issue I could notice is a fairly significant drop in FPS that happens whenever more than a couple of outlying buildings are in view. My FPS is locked at 32 and usually stays close most of the time but it can, in this case drop as low as 4.

More of a minor detail: are you sure the retention pools south of the base are often filled? all pics I've seen this past 10 years seem to have them empty.
